How often do the credit bureaus update scores? Is there a set date each month?
Your FICO score is a snapshot of what is happening to your CR at the time the report is pulled. Conceivably, your score can change everyday.
If you are pulling your score from a source other than myFICO, then take heed. Scores purchased through any other source may not be FICO scores, but a fake score. The CRAs (except for EQ) sell their own version that tries to mimic FICO, but are not accurate or the same.
